Software Engineer II - Detection Engine (Full-Stack Javascript) Job at Elastic, United States

NUZkZWJMZ09rd1BIVEw0ZWVVM1cxQmNVZnc9PQ==
  • Elastic
  • United States

Job Description

What is The Role

The Elastic Security solution helps teams protect, investigate, and respond to threats before damage is done. On the Elastic Search AI Platform — and fueled by advanced analytics with years of data from across your attack surface — it eliminates data silos, automates prevention and detection, and streamlines investigation and response. The Elastic stack is widely used among the security analyst community, and our team is working to improve the user experience and workflows of these analysts. Exciting challenges await, including collecting data relevant to users, hosts, and cloud instances, aggregating and visualizing that data, providing insights into anomalous activity, and supporting the investigation phase of a Security Analyst workflow.

The team is diverse and distributed, but connected! You will be working remotely with some amazing Elasticians across the USA and Europe. We meet via Zoom, brainstorm in Google docs, discuss in open GitHub issues, and chat on Slack.

The Detection Engine team provides the core correlation and evaluation logic that powers detection rules and alerts. Their work ensures alerts are timely, relevant, and low-noise, giving analysts confidence in what they see.

What You Will Be Doing



  • Write and maintain high-quality Typescript code.

  • Experience developing Kibana plugins.

  • Create visualizations and UI workflows that serve security analytics use cases.

  • Create Node.js background tasks that do data searches and manipulations.

  • Work on open-source and make SIEM technologies available to a lot of new users.

  • Work with our support team to help customers and answer community questions.

What You Bring



  • 4+ Experience with developing and maintaining reasonably sophisticated software projects with high quality and over multiple years.

  • Hands-on experience with {Node.js, Typescript, React/Angular, GraphQL}.

  • Ability to work in a distributed team throughout the world.

  • Interest and experience in various types of automated testing.

  • Experience with Kibana/Elasticsearch is a plus

Job Tags

Full time, Remote work,

Similar Jobs

Core Executive Recruiting

Chief Engineer Job at Core Executive Recruiting

 ...This role oversees the engineering operations of a large Class A commercial property, ensuring all building systems, maintenance programs, and safety standards are executed with excellence. The position requires a handson leader who can manage staff, guide contractors... 

Baptist Health System - San Antonio TX

Clinical Pharmacist Job at Baptist Health System - San Antonio TX

 ...Job Description Baptist Health System - San Antonio TX is seeking a Clinical Pharmacist for a job in New Braunfels, Texas. Job Description & Requirements ~ Specialty: Clinical Pharmacist ~ Discipline: Allied Health Professional ~ Duration: Ongoing ~40... 

GovernmentJobs.com

POLICE RECORDS ASSISTANT-TEMP Job at GovernmentJobs.com

 ...Records Assistant Cary, NC is passionate about putting the needs of our citizens first and our nationally accredited Police Department has helped ensure we stay one of the safest places to live in the nation. Now you can join our team to help us continue meeting the... 

Tennessee Staffing

Armed Special Response Security Officer Job at Tennessee Staffing

 ...Armed Special Response Security Officer GardaWorld Security Services is now hiring an Armed + Taser Response Security Officer! Ready to suit up as a Special Response Armed with Taser Security Guard? What matters most in a role like this is your ability to adapt from... 

Robert Half

Packaging Designer Job at Robert Half

 ...creative outputs. Manage pre- and post-production processes, including proof reviews and vendor coordination. Create 2D and 3D renderings of packaging and displays. Collaborate cross-functionally with marketing and creative teams to deliver impactful designs....